Output 64da66724d0f1146a5bb3d61b1e25e1c18281be2856497b6e46fc8a7cfb50a56:64

value
421344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 939bebdda26365df50ba7d8c3753b3b2cb4b2438 OP_EQUAL
address
3F9W3M9aCY9kQpecSNUYs8B4Li8gBeE9CE
transaction
64da66724d0f1146a5bb3d61b1e25e1c18281be2856497b6e46fc8a7cfb50a56
spent
true